Understanding Your Window Systems

Before diving into upkeep treatments, property owners benefit from developing a fundamental understanding of their window types and elements. Modern windows consist of several incorporated systems that interact to supply insulation, ventilation, security, and aesthetic appeal. The main components consist of the frame structure, which may be built from wood, vinyl, aluminum, or composite products; the glazing system, making up one or more panes of glass separated by insulating gas areas; the weatherstripping materials that create seals against air and water seepage; and the operating hardware including locks, hinges, deals with, and tilt mechanisms.

Each window product provides special maintenance requirements that directly influence care methods. Wood frames require routine painting or staining to protect versus wetness damage and need vigilance for signs of rot or insect invasion. Vinyl frames, while typically low-maintenance, can become brittle over time and may require regular inspection of bonded corners and weatherstripping. Aluminum frames, known for their strength and slim profiles, require specific attention to thermal bridging problems and routine lubrication of moving elements. Understanding these material-specific characteristics makes it possible for property owners to customize their upkeep approaches properly, guaranteeing that well-intentioned care efforts produce favorable rather than destructive results.

Regular Cleaning and Inspection Protocols

Establishing a consistent cleansing and evaluation schedule forms the structure of effective window maintenance. Industry specialists suggest performing thorough window evaluations a minimum of twice yearly, ideally during spring and fall transitions when weather condition patterns shift substantially. These bi-annual evaluations need to take a look at both exterior and interior surface areas, with specific attention to areas that experience accelerated wear or build up debris.

The cleaning process starts with getting rid of loose dirt and particles from window surface areas utilizing a soft brush or microfiber fabric. For exterior glass, a solution of moderate meal soap and water applied with a soft squeegee or lint-free fabric usually is enough for regular cleaning. property owners ought to avoid abrasive cleaners, harsh chemicals, or rough scrubbing materials that can scratch glass surfaces or damage protective coverings. Expert glass cleaners work well for eliminating persistent fingerprints, grease, or tough water spots, though testing a little inconspicuous location very first helps avoid potential damage to specialized finishings or tints.

Throughout cleaning sessions, inspectors must assess the condition of all visible elements. This evaluation includes looking for split or broken glass, analyzing weatherstripping for spaces, tears, or compression, examining frame surface areas for damage or wear and tear, and validating that operating hardware functions efficiently. Recording findings during each assessment produces an important maintenance history that helps identify emerging problems before they escalate into expensive repairs.

Weatherstripping: The Critical Seal

Weatherstripping represents the unsung hero of window performance, silently avoiding air leaks that drive energy costs and compromise indoor comfort. This flexible material, set up around sash boundaries and door frames, compresses when windows near develop a protective barrier versus drafts, wetness, and outside sound. Gradually, weatherstripping goes through considerable stress from repeated compression, temperature level cycling, and exposure to ultraviolet radiation, gradually losing its effectiveness and requiring replacement.

Recognizing jeopardized weatherstripping involves visual evaluation and basic functional tests. House owners ought to search for visible fractures, tears, or breaks in the material, locations where the weatherstripping has pulled away from its mounting surface area, and flattened or compressed sections that no longer provide significant resistance when compressed in between fingers. The candle light test, moving a lit candle gradually around closed window boundaries on a windy day, exposes air leakages through flame discrepancy that often escapes notice through regular experience.

Replacement weatherstripping materials are readily available in numerous configurations including V-strip foam tape, tubular rubber or vinyl gaskets, and felt strips. Selection depends on window type, climate conditions, and spending plan considerations. Installation typically involves cleaning the application surface thoroughly, getting rid of old weatherstripping totally, measuring and cutting new product to precise lengths, and applying according to manufacturer instructions with suitable adhesives or self-adhesive backing.

Hardware Maintenance and Operating Mechanisms

The mechanical components allowing window operation require routine attention to make sure smooth function and safe closure. Window hardware consists of locks, manages, hinges, tilt latches, and balance systems, each serving particular functions that jointly identify window performance. Ignoring hardware upkeep typically results in progressively difficult operation, compromised security, and eventual element failure.

Lubrication represents the foundation of hardware upkeep. Moving parts such as hinge pins, lock mechanisms, and tilt latches benefit from routine application of silicone-based lubricants or graphite powder. These lubes supply smooth operation without bring in dirt and debris that can accumulate with oil-based products. Homeowners need to apply lube moderately, clean away excess, and operate the window several cycles to distribute the lubricant equally throughout the system.

Lock adjustment becomes needed when windows stop working to close completely or when locks feel loose or unresponsive. A lot of modern windows include adjustment screws that control lock engagement depth. Tightening up or loosening up these screws, generally situated near the lock mechanism, can restore appropriate alignment and protected closure. When change shows insufficient, hardware replacement may be needed, requiring compatible replacement parts sourced from the window producer or third-party suppliers.

Glass Care and Structural Integrity

Preserving glass integrity extends beyond cleaning up to encompass defense against damage and timely repair of any concerns. While modern glazing systems show remarkably durable, thermal stress, impact damage, and seal failures can compromise efficiency and need expert attention. Property owners should comprehend fundamental glass maintenance principles while acknowledging the limits of diy repair work.

Minor scratches in glass surface areas can sometimes be reduced using specialized polishing substances planned for glass repair. Nevertheless, deeper scratches, chips, or cracks generally need pane replacement instead of repair attempts that may intensify the damage. Homeowners should resolve any glass damage quickly, as relatively small issues can advance rapidly, especially under thermal stress or effect loads.

Insulated glass units, including 2 or more panes separated by gas-filled spaces, need particular attention to seal stability. Seal failure manifests as fogging or condensation in between panes, indicating that the hermetic seal has actually been jeopardized and the insulating gas got away. Seasonal Maintenance Considerations

Various seasons present unique window maintenance difficulties and chances. Spring maintenance following winter season's departure offers opportunity for thorough examination after thermal tension and possible storm damage. This assessment should verify that all running systems made it through winter season intact, analyze weatherstripping for compression set or damage, and clean tracks and channels that may have collected winter season debris.

Summertime's heat and intense ultraviolet direct exposure speed up deterioration of exposed materials, making this an ideal time to examine and replace any weatherstripping showing summertime wear, tidy and lube hardware before fall's increased use, and apply protective treatments to wooden frames if required. Fall maintenance concentrates on preparing windows for winter challenges, making sure seals are intact, weatherstripping remains in excellent condition, and operating mechanisms are oiled and operating effectively before cold weather needs maximum efficiency from window systems.

Winter window care, while less comprehensive than other seasons, must consist of keeping track of for condensation issues that might indicate interior humidity issues or seal failures, keeping tracks clear of ice build-up that can damage operating mechanisms, and dealing with any drafts immediately to avoid energy losses throughout peak heating season.

Regularly Asked Questions

How typically should windows be changed rather than fixed?

Window replacement choices depend upon multiple elements consisting of the age of the windows, the nature of existing problems, energy efficiency goals, and spending plan considerations. Windows approaching or surpassing their anticipated life-span, generally twenty to thirty years for many quality setups, frequently show better prospects for replacement than repair. Nevertheless, windows with separated damage such as damaged glass, failed hardware, or shabby weatherstripping can financially extend their service life through targeted repair work. Expert evaluation supplies valuable insight into whether repair or replacement represents the more practical financial investment for specific scenarios.

What triggers condensation on window surfaces, and how can it be dealt with?

Interior surface area condensation arises from excess humidity within the home contacting cooler window surface areas. This phenomenon suggests that indoor wetness levels surpass what the window glass surface temperature level can deal with without producing visible water. Solutions consist of enhancing ventilation through exhaust fans and opening windows quickly, utilizing dehumidifiers in humid climates or seasons, ensuring exhaust systems vent correctly to exterior rather than attics or crawl areas, and considering window upgrades with improved thermal efficiency that raise interior glass surface temperatures. Condensation between panes suggests sealed system failure requiring replacement of the insulated glass system.

Can DIY maintenance void window guarantees?

Numerous window manufacturers require expert installation and defined upkeep treatments to keep warranty coverage. House owners should examine guarantee documents carefully before carrying out upkeep tasks that might impact protection. Generally, routine cleaning and lubrication using manufacturer-approved items falls within acceptable upkeep activities. However, modifications to hardware, usage of improper cleansing representatives, or incorrect repair work might void guarantee securities. When unpredictability exists, speaking with the manufacturer or a licensed company before proceeding safeguards both the guarantee and the window system's integrity.

What are the most typical indications that window upkeep is needed?

Caution indications indicating necessary window maintenance include difficult operation requiring excessive force to open or close, visible damage to frames, glass, or weatherstripping, drafts felt near closed windows noticeable by hand or candle test, condensation between panes or on interior surface areas, air leakages noticeable through smoke or incense motion, pest intrusion around window borders, and water spots or damage on surrounding walls or trim. Dealing with these caution indications immediately avoids small problems from escalating into major problems requiring extensive repair or complete replacement.
